The Israeli occupation exploits the health conditions and the crises caused by the outbreak of the Corona virus, to pass its Judaization plans, and its settlement ambitions in the blessed Al-Aqsa Mosque, to change the status quo in it, and to impose a new reality on Jerusalemites, amid their preoccupation with taking preventive measures against the emerging disease.

The occupation conducted a series of dangerous measures in the city of Jerusalem and the blessed Al-Aqsa Mosque, the most prominent of which is the closure of the main doors of the Temple Mount, leading to its courtyards, with the opening of the Mughrabi Gate, which it controls, and the religious Jews taking to pray at the Al-Buraq Wall, and settlers enter it during their storming of the blessed mosque.

A recent study issued by the Jerusalem Center for Studies of Israeli and Palestinian Affairs confirms that the number of settlers who stormed the blessed Al-Aqsa Mosque during the month of March increased, despite the closure of its main doors, as part of the measures to prevent the spread of the Corona virus, as the number of settlers who stormed Al-Aqsa during the past month reached to 1604 settlers, including members of the Israeli army, in their military clothes.

The study indicates that the number of settlers storming Al-Aqsa Mosque reached 1423, in addition to 98 Israeli students, and 83 members of the occupation intelligence.

The study of the Jerusalem Center for Studies says: “It was, in the middle of the month, the occupation closed a number of doors of the blessed Al-Aqsa Mosque, under the pretext of preventing the spread of (Corona), and it was noted that settler incursions continued during the closure period.”
